Welsh builders merchant Huws Gray has gained Forest Stewardship Council (FSC) chain of custody certification on machined softwood products.

The company, which has more than 30 branches covering north Wales and north-west England, announced the award on ‘FSC Friday’, a global initiative to promote sustainable forest management.

“Builders, local authorities and housing associations increasingly require certified timber,” said Huws Gray business development manager Dafydd Williams. “FSC chain of custody means that Huws Gray customers can now obtain a core range of machined softwood products from our branches.”

The company was helped in preparing for FSC certification by SCA Timber Supply, whose forests passed a decade of FSC forest management certification earlier this year.

SCA’s environment & QA manager Bob Bastow, said: “Many pre-qualification tendering questionnaires for local authority and housing association ask for details of timber certification among the required environmental and social criteria.

“In today’s tough market, it’s even more important for merchants like Huws Gray to give themselves every possible chance when competing for this valuable business.”
